Hakwe is a new Black Hole CO in Advance Wars 2, and is supposedly the second-in-command. He leads the invasion of [[Green Earth]], and dissappears when it is liberated. He shows up after the last battle, where he kills Sturm and seizes power, thereby saving the commanders from the other nations.

In Advance Wars: Dual Strike, Hawke is relegated to normal CO status after power in the Black Hole army has been seized by [[Von Bolt]]. He questions the motives the [[Bolt Guard]] has and is eventually branded a traitor by Von Bolt, forcing him to switch allegiance to the [[Allied Nations]], from which point onward he is a usable CO. After defeating decisively defeating Von Bolt, Hawke dissappears yet again.

In Advance Wars 2, Hawke is only interested in his power and how far it would bring him; however, in Advance Wars: Dual Strike, it is shown that he has a different side as he is responsible for the restoration of the land.
